Our 800 student school is a Title I school in Phoenix, Arizona. 99.5% of our students are English Language Learners. For many these students are the first members of their families to learn the English Language. I am very proud of them- both for their successes and defeats alike.
The children tell me (almost daily) how difficult it can be to have a language barrier in their home. Even with the most involved and dedicated of parents, communication between students and their parents at home with regard to school-related business (homework, grades, materials, projects, etc.) proves difficult. My students absolutely love connecting material we've learned in class to real-world concepts. They are true lovers of nonfiction text, because it helps open their eyes to see a world of possibilities and dreams that are out there and ready for them.
